Live Blackjack

This is my bread and butter. The house edge is typically around 0.5% with basic strategy, making it one of the best odds games. I usually stick to tables using 6-8 decks. I often play Evolution Gaming's Infinite Blackjack or Free Bet Blackjack because they allow an unlimited number of players at a single table, so I never have to wait. I've seen some incredible runs on these, like when I hit a 21 on a double down against a dealer 6 and pocketed $1,200. For higher stakes, I'll hit a Salon Privé Blackjack table, where minimums start at $1,000, and I have the dealer all to myself.

Live Roulette

I almost exclusively play European Roulette because its single zero means a lower house edge (2.7%) compared to American Roulette's double zero (5.26%). I'm a fan of Lightning Roulette, where up to five numbers per round can get random multipliers between 50x and 500x. I once hit a 200x multiplier on a $5 straight-up bet, turning it into $1,000. It's exhilarating! For a more relaxed game, French Roulette with its "La Partage" rule (half even-money bets returned on zero) is excellent for reducing losses.

Live Baccarat

Baccarat is deceptively simple and fast-paced. I almost always bet on the Banker hand, which has a slightly better statistical edge (house edge around 1.06%, though it comes with a 5% commission on wins). It’s a game where you can get a lot of hands in a short time. I’ve had many sessions where I've grinded out steady profits, like the time I turned $500 into $1,800 over two hours just consistently betting Banker.

Live Game Shows

These are pure entertainment and can offer massive payouts. Crazy Time is a personal favorite for its bonus rounds (Coin Flip, Cash Hunt, Pachinko, Crazy Time wheel). I’ve seen the multipliers go up to 25,000x! Similarly, Monopoly Live with its 3D bonus board can deliver huge wins, especially when Mr. Monopoly adds multipliers to properties. Decoding Live Dealer Bonuses and Promotions

I always check the bonus terms before claiming anything. Many casinos offer welcome bonuses, but the devil is in the details, especially for live games.

* Wagering Requirements: This tells you how many times you need to bet the bonus amount (and sometimes the deposit) before you can withdraw. I look for 30x-40x wagering. Anything higher, and it's usually not worth my time. * Game Contribution: This is crucial for live dealer players. While slots often contribute 100% to wagering requirements, live table games might only contribute 5% or 10%. So, a $100 bet on live blackjack might only count as $10 towards clearing your bonus. I factor this in heavily. * Bet Limits: Some bonuses have max bet limits while wagering. I always double-check this to avoid voiding my bonus by accidentally betting too high.
